called up the jury duty hotline sunday night to see if i had to report for duty but i was told not to come in until tuesday...so i called up my bro to hit up perris for a couple hours...his friend wanted to test out the boat he just bought so off we went....got there late around 9 and went searching for the slabs....looks like the slabs are creeping out slowly...the small 3/4 pounders are out already..give it a couple more weeks than the big boys are ready to play too...seen a couple nice 1-2 pound redears being caught from shore...i'll be back very soon :LOL:


all about this size 3/4-1 pounders
http://i7.photobucket.com/albums/y282/seng90806/IMG_0589.jpg

mostly caught on red/white curly tali jigs
